> Is there anything as font-stretch in use in these [CJK-]fonts?
Many CJK fonts come in two variants: monospaced and proportional
Calling this attribute "font-stretch" is a bit of a stretch though... in this
case the other commonly terms
"proportion" or pitch" are more appropriate
@tora/@khirano: are you aware of any CJK font families that have other
pitch-variants than monospaced
or proportional, e.g. condensed or expanded?
